To download the MP TET (Madhya Pradesh Teacher Eligibility Test) admit card, you will need the following details:

  1. Registration number: You will need to enter the registration number that was assigned to you at the time of the application process. This is a unique identification number that is used to track your application and exam details.
  2. Date of Birth: You will need to enter your date of birth in the format of DD/MM/YYYY as provided during the application process.

Once you enter these details correctly, you will be able to download the MP TET admit card from the official website of MP PEB.

Candidates can download the MP TET admit card as per the process

  • Visit esb.mp.gov.in
  • Select the language
  • Click on the hall ticket
  • Go through the instructions carefully 
  • Enter the application number and date of birth
  • Download the admit card
  • Take a printout

No, the MP TET (Madhya Pradesh Teacher Eligibility Test) admit card will not be sent to you by post. The admit card can only be downloaded online from the official website of MP PEB. Once the admit card is released, you can download it by visiting the official website of MP PEB and entering your registration number and date of birth. The admit card will contain important information such as the exam date and time, exam center details, and instructions for the exam day.

No, you cannot show the digital copy of the MP TET (Madhya Pradesh Teacher Eligibility Test) admit card at the exam center. You must carry a printed copy of the admit card. The MP TET admit card has details such as your name, registration number, roll number, exam date and time, center address, and guidelines.

The CG TET exam duration is 2 hours 30 minutes. The exam is held in two shifts, Paper 1 in the morning and Paper 2 in the afternoon.

The CG TET exam has two papers: Paper 1 and Paper 2. Have a look at the difference between CG TET Paper 1 and CG TET Paper 2 below

  • CG TET Paper 1 is for candidates who want to teach Classes 1 to 5 in Chhattisgarh schools. The CG TET Paper 2 is for candidates who want to teach Classes 6 to 8. Candidates who want to teach Classes 1 to 8 need to appear for both papers.
  • The CG TET syllabus and exam pattern for Paper 1 and Paper 2 are different in terms of subjects, topics and question and marks distribution.
  • The CG TET Paper 1 questions will be based on 6 to 11 age group of children and Paper 2 will be based on 11 to 14 age group of children.
